2.7 Web3 payments and blockchain data
When you pay for a subscription or Credit Store package via Web3, we collect and process:
- Your public wallet address connected during the payment flow
- Transaction hash(es) you submit or that we derive for verification
- The package or plan identifier associated with the payment
This information is linked to your user account ID to verify payment, activate or renew subscriptions, credit your wallet, prevent fraud, and enforce idempotency (preventing duplicate crediting from the same on-chain transaction).
We do not receive, request, or store your private keys, seed phrases, or wallet passwords.
2.8 Private keys and seed phrases
Execution Mind never requests, collects, stores, or has access to your private keys, seed phrases, or wallet passwords. Wallet connection is limited to public address and transaction signing through your own wallet software.
We will never ask for this information via support, email, in-app chat, or any other channel. Any such request is fraudulent and should be reported to us immediately.
2.9 Public nature of blockchain transactions
On-chain USDT transfers on BSC are publicly visible on blockchain explorers (for example, BscScan). Anyone with your wallet address or a transaction hash may view the amount, timestamp, and sender and receiver addresses involved.
Execution Mind cannot make blockchain records private or remove them from the public ledger after a transaction is confirmed.
